4.4 Historic Menu
4.4.1 Alarm Menu
Displays the last 200 system alarms, peak value alarms and event logs, and all
the active alarms.
1)
System alarms:
•
Low sample flow
When the sample flow goes below 10 cc/min with a sample flow set point
greater than 10 cc/min.
•
Low carrier flow
When the carrier flow falls below 5 cc/min for the plasma detector for 30
seconds,
a “Plasma #X on I/O Board #X shut down”
alarm will be initiated
to protect the system by turning off the #X plasma detector.
•
Plasma shut down
When a “Low carrier flow” alarm remains active for 30 seconds, turns the
plasma detector off.
•
Plasma OFF
When the cell signal counts are lower than the starting count, it indicates that
the plasma detector is physically off.
•
Starting
The plasma is restarted when the following is true
-
“Plasma off” alarm is active
-
“Low carrier flow” alarm
is inactive
-
Starting
mode
is
automatic
(see
section
SYSTEM
CONFIGURATION MENU
for the
Starting mode
definition)
-
No cycle is progressing (real-time chromatogram stopped or between
cycles)
